Possibilities and challenges of China׳s forestry biomass resource utilization
Zhongfu Tan,
Kangting Chen and
Pingkuo Liu
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ews, 2015, vol. 41, issue C, 368-378
Abstract:
Forestry biomass resource has many advantages, which makes it a significant new energy to substitute fossil energy as an important role of biomass resources. For the utilization of China׳s forestry biomass resources, this paper analyzed the possibilities of its development from the aspect of policy, resource endowment, market and technology, and discussed its development challenges from the aspect of policy, economy, society, technology and resource endowment. Forestry biomass resources are very abundant in China. It has made a significant breakthrough in forest biomass resource utilization, with great prospects. Although there are still some difficulties and challenges in the policy, resource endowment and other aspects, these challenges are not insurmountable. Therefore, forestry biomass resources should develop in a way with Chinese characteristics considering the national condition.
